Chainlink, the largest Oracle solution in the crypto space and a monopoly in the field, has taken another significant step. The team has officially launched the cross-chain interoperability protocol on the mainnet, which they previously announced for interoperability across multiple networks. So what does this mean for LINK token and Chainlink? Chainlink (LINK) News Chainlink has launched the cross-chain interoperability protocol (CCIP) in the “early access” stage, which is designed to connect applications on both public and private blockchains. This is a highly important move for the multi-chain future and will have a positive impact on Chainlink’s future. In their recent announcement, the team stated, “This will provide a unified interface for seamless interactions.” CCIP is being used by the decentralized finance protocol Synthetix on the mainnet to enhance cross-chain transfers between Ethereum, Optimism, and other chains.
